The US Federal Reserve is requesting public input on its proposed “payment account,” dubbed a “skinny master account” which fintechs and crypto firms are drawn to as it would allow access to the central bank without needing the typical approvals.

"These new payment accounts would support innovation while keeping the payments system safe," Fed Governor Christopher Waller said on Friday. In October, Waller recommended that the Fed explore the idea of implementing payment accounts to clear and settle certain transaction activities of eligible financial institutions.

Waller added the Fed is introducing the payment accounts feature to reflect the “rapid developments” in the payments industry that have led to “innovative approaches to banking” and new changes in business models.

“This tailoring could result in lower risk to the payment system and, as a result, requests for payment accounts could generally receive a streamlined review.”

Not all Fed officials agreed with the decision to seek public input, with Governor Michael Barr arguing that it could pose risks if safeguards against money laundering and terrorist financing are not clearly defined, especially for institutions the Fed does not directly supervise.

Several payment-focused crypto firms could be in the running to connect to the Fed’s banking rails, potentially strengthening the bridge between crypto and traditional banking. Among the largest US-based crypto payments companies are Circle, Coinbase, Kraken, and Block, Inc.

Source: Federal Reserve


Inclusion of crypto firms into the Fed’s banking system would mark a significant turnaround for the industry. Crypto companies last year claimed the Biden administration worked to deliberately cut them off from banking services to stifle the industry with what crypto backers have dubbed Operation Chokepoint 2.0.

Waller noted that the Fed has already been experimenting with blockchain-based payment technologies to modernize the US payment system.

Crypto wouldn’t get the same privileges

Payment platforms granted payment accounts, however, won’t receive the same privileges as big banks and Wall Street institutions that currently have master accounts.

Unlike master accounts, the proposed payment accounts would not earn interest, have access to Fed credit, and would be subject to balance caps, among other restrictions.

The comment period to give feedback on the payments account plan will close 45 days after publication in the Federal Register. Waller said last month that the payment account feature is expected to be operational in the fourth quarter of 2026.

Huang Renxun Dramatically 'Saves' South Korean Stock Market

In early June, South Korea's stock market experienced a sharp decline, with the KOSPI index dropping over 5% and triggering a trading halt. Amid this volatility, NVIDIA CEO Jensen Huang's visit to Seoul provided a dramatic boost to market sentiment. During his trip, Huang held a dinner meeting with SK Group Chairman Chey Tae-won and SK Hynix CEO Kwak Noh-Jung. He announced that NVIDIA's new Vera CPU would utilize SK Hynix DRAM and confirmed a multi-year technical collaboration between the two companies. This partnership aims to co-develop next-generation memory for NVIDIA's AI infrastructure roadmap, covering products from data center supercomputers to personal AI devices. Huang also publicly commented that AI company stocks were attractively priced. A key announcement was that NVIDIA's upcoming Vera Rubin AI supercomputer systems will use HBM4 memory, with supply qualifications granted to all three major suppliers: SK Hynix, Samsung Electronics, and Micron Technology. Despite this multi-sourcing strategy, Huang warned that the industry-wide chip shortage, affecting everything from wafers to packaging, is expected to persist for several years due to relentless demand from global AI factory construction. The collaboration extends beyond memory supply. SK Hynix will employ NVIDIA's AI platforms and Omniverse digital twin technology to enhance its own semiconductor design, simulation, and manufacturing processes, aiming for more autonomous factory operations. This visit builds upon a prior October 2025 agreement for SK Group to build a large-scale AI data center using over 50,000 NVIDIA GPUs. Huang's itinerary also included meetings with other Korean giants like Hyundai, LG, and Samsung, indicating NVIDIA's broader strategy to deepen ties with South Korea's tech industry.

When Inference Becomes a Scarce Resource, Who Captures the Value?

When Inference Becomes the Scarce Resource, Who Captures the Value? The core AI bottleneck has shifted from model training to inference (runtime execution). While concerns persisted about an "AI compute gap"—initially a $200B, now a $600B problem—the market is now recognizing that the solution and value lie in the inference layer. Nvidia's financial restructuring around "serving tokens" and Cerebras's successful IPO highlight this shift. Inference is a recurring, usage-based cost, estimated to be 10-50x larger than the one-time training market, especially with the rise of agentic AI. The inference stack spans six layers: silicon (e.g., Nvidia), bare metal (e.g., CoreWeave), GPU rental/aggregation, deployment/optimization, model APIs, and end applications. Most companies operate in one layer. However, Hyperbolic uniquely spans three layers (GPU rental, deployment, and model APIs) without owning any hardware. It aggregates fragmented GPU supply from multiple cloud providers into a standardized pool, offering developers the cheapest available compute through intelligent routing. Its multi-cloud aggregation creates a data moat and a flywheel: more supply leads to better pricing data and liquidity, attracting more developers and providers. In contrast, applications like Venice operate at the top of the stack, reselling privacy-wrapped inference but remaining dependent on and constrained by the underlying compute costs they purchase. As inference demand explodes, value accrues not just to consumer applications but increasingly to the aggregation and routing layer that captures their cost of revenue. The coming potential GPU oversupply reinforces this dynamic. While hardware owners may suffer from depreciation, asset-light aggregators like Hyperbolic benefit from price arbitrage, routing workloads to the cheapest available capacity. The ultimate winner in the inference economy may not be the entity with the most GPUs, but the one that can most efficiently discover, aggregate, and route the world's fragmented compute.
